CubsWoo posted:I don't count either of those as full-timers but I guess Cena? I can't remember if he was full time back then but if he wasn't he was well on the way Televised/PPV Matches (and totals with house shows) for John Cena: 2017 (to date): 11/41 2016: 12/50 2015: 40/136 2014: 53/164 2013: 34/142 2012: 48/184 2011: 53/202 2010: 57/178 2009: 58/166 2008: 42/83 2007: 46/113 The last year other "part timers" did double digit tv/ppv matches: Undertaker: 2010 (13 matches) Triple H: 2010 (16 matches) Brock Lesnar: 2003 (42 matches) Goldberg: 2003 (26 matches) Rock: 2002 (30 matches) I grant you that the writing has been on the wall of "Cena Won't Be Around Forever" for years now, but he's in a class apart from the other "part timers".

Edge & Christian posted:If we're calling John Cena a part-timer, we need some sort of secondary term for "almost no-timers" or something. John Cena in 2012 wrestled on TV/PPV 48 times and including house shows about 180 days. Cena's taken time off to do other projects, but it's kind of remarkable just how dedicated he was to WWE up until about a year ago. Good data, and I can admit I was wrong about Cena being part time in 2012. I think it's still telling that the only losses Brock has taken in five years were to: Cena (ER '12) HHH (WM 29) Cena (DQ, NoC '14) Rollins (Pinned Reigns in triple threat via cash-in, WM 31) Undertaker (SummerSlam '15, dick attack/dirty loss) Reigns (Pinned Ambrose in triple threat, Fastlane '16) Goldberg (Survivor Series '16) plus two Royal Rumbles he entered but did not win. That's one clean loss in a standard match, two clean losses in no holds barred matches, two losses in multi-man matches where he wasn't pinned, a DQ loss and a dirty loss after a low blow.
